def add_src_path(path: str) -> str:
"""
add a folder to the paths, so we can import from there
:param path: path to add
:return: absolute path
"""
if not os.path.isabs(path):
# use the absolute path, otherwise some other things (e.g. __file__) won't work properly
path = os.path.abspath(path)
if not os.path.isdir(path):
raise ClickException(f"Specified source folder does not exist: {path}")
if path not in sys.path:
sys.path.insert(0, path)
return path

def get_tortoise_config(ctx: Context, tortoise_orm: str) -> dict:
"""
get tortoise config from module
:param ctx:
:param tortoise_orm:
:return:
"""
splits = tortoise_orm.split(".")
config_path = ".".join(splits[:-1])
tortoise_config = splits[-1]
try:
config_module = importlib.import_module(config_path)
except ModuleNotFoundError as e:
raise ClickException(f"Error while importing configuration module: {e}") from None
config = getattr(config_module, tortoise_config, None)
if not config:
raise BadOptionUsage(
option_name="--config",
message=f'Can\'t get "{tortoise_config}" from module "{config_module}"',
ctx=ctx,
)
return config

def get_dict_diff_by_key(
old_fields: list[dict], new_fields: list[dict], key="through"
) -> Generator[tuple]:
"""
Compare two list by key instead of by index
:param old_fields: previous field info list
:param new_fields: current field info list
:param key: if two dicts have the same value of this key, action is change; otherwise, is remove/add
:return: similar to dictdiffer.diff
Example::
>>> old = [{'through': 'a'}, {'through': 'b'}, {'through': 'c'}]
>>> new = [{'through': 'a'}, {'through': 'c'}] # remove the second element
>>> list(diff(old, new))
[('change', [1, 'through'], ('b', 'c')),
('remove', '', [(2, {'through': 'c'})])]
>>> list(get_dict_diff_by_key(old, new))
[('remove', '', [(0, {'through': 'b'})])]
"""
length_old, length_new = len(old_fields), len(new_fields)
if length_old == 0 or length_new == 0 or length_old == length_new == 1:
yield from diff(old_fields, new_fields)
else:
value_index: dict[str, int] = {f[key]: i for i, f in enumerate(new_fields)}
additions = set(range(length_new))
for field in old_fields:
value = field[key]
if (index := value_index.get(value)) is not None:
additions.remove(index)
yield from diff([field], [new_fields[index]]) # change
else:
yield from diff([field], []) # remove
if additions:
for index in sorted(additions):
yield from diff([], [new_fields[index]]) # add
